HTTP::Request
Jo
- perl
Hallo zusammen,
ich benutze das Perl Modul HTTP:Request um Anfragen an einen Server zu richten. Diese werden allerdings über das Protokoll HTTP 1.0 übermittelt. Kann man das Modul irgendwie anweisen HTTP 1.1 zu verwenden? Habe im Internet bisher noch keine Infos gefunden.
Jo
Halihallo Jo
ich benutze das Perl Modul HTTP:Request um Anfragen an einen Server zu richten. Diese werden allerdings über das Protokoll HTTP 1.0 übermittelt. Kann man das Modul irgendwie anweisen HTTP 1.1 zu verwenden? Habe im Internet bisher noch keine Infos gefunden.
Versende das HTTP::Request über LWP::UserAgent und setze dort ein
keep_alive => 1. Keep-Alive Verbindungen gibt es erst seit HTTP/1.1
und somit müsste er zwingend einen HTTP/1.1 Request absenden. Die
Module sind zumindest HTTP/1.1 capable.
HTTP::Request erbt von HTTP::Message. Dort lässt sich das HTTP-
Protokoll über $msg->protocol('HTTP/1.1') festlegen, ob dann auch
HTTP/1.1 verwendet wird, kann ich nicht umgehend mit 100%-iger
Sicherheit aus dem Ärmel schütteln.
Viele Grüsse
Philipp